public void DoPayByCode() { CommonDic.getInstance().setParameters("subject", "game"); CommonDic.getInstance().setParameters("body", "gamePay"); CommonDic.getInstance().setParameters("order_id", getRamdomTestOrderID()); CommonDic.getInstance().setParameters("total", "0"); CommonDic.getInstance().setParameters("goods_tag", "game"); CommonDic.getInstance().setParameters("notify_url", "www.picovr.com"); CommonDic.getInstance().setParameters("pay_code", GameObject.Find("CodeText").GetComponent <Text>().text); Debug.Log("商品码支付" + GameObject.Find("CodeText").GetComponent <Text>().text); StartLoading(); GameObject.Find("CodeText").GetComponent <Text>().text = ""; InputPanel.SetActive(false); PicoPaymentSDK.Pay(CommonDic.getInstance().PayOrderString()); }
void OnClick(GameObject btnObj) { switch (btnObj.name) { case "Login": StartLoading(); LoginSDK.Login(); break; case "PayOne": CommonDic.getInstance().setParameters("subject", "game"); CommonDic.getInstance().setParameters("body", "gamePay"); CommonDic.getInstance().setParameters("order_id", getRamdomTestOrderID()); CommonDic.getInstance().setParameters("total", "1"); CommonDic.getInstance().setParameters("goods_tag", "game"); CommonDic.getInstance().setParameters("notify_url", "www.picovr.com"); CommonDic.getInstance().setParameters("pay_code", ""); StartLoading(); PicoPaymentSDK.Pay(CommonDic.getInstance().PayOrderString()); break; case "PayCode": InputPanel.SetActive(true); break; case "QueryOrder": StartLoading(); PicoPaymentSDK.QueryOrder(currentOrderID); break; case "GetUserAPI": StartLoading(); LoginSDK.GetUserAPI(); break; } }
public static void GetUserAPI() { PicoPaymentSDK.GetUserAPI(); }
public static void Login() { PicoPaymentSDK.Login(); }